SUMMARY
After 0a9f9fe1063 [1], several applications will "spam" the following (and
possibly similar) line(s):
IFFChunk::innerFromDevice: unkwnown chunk "\x89PNG"
1.
https://invent.kde.org/frameworks/kimageformats/-/commit/0a9f9fe106368f8c21645de82c7843947d7bab77
ST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. Run something like Falkon (a clean profile might not trigger the issue,
since specific (png?) files are needed, but with some history or speed-dial
data it's probably quite likely to see; I did not dig in deeper yet).
2. Type something on the search bar to pick up specific type of icons, or set a
background/something else on the speed-dial.
OBSERVED RESULT
Lost and lots of terminal logging output.
EXPECTED RESULT
Not so lots and lots of terminal logging output.
SOFTWARE/OS VERSIONS
Linux/KDE Plasma: Gentoo Linux (Not a full Plasma install, but using KWin with
LXQt.)
KDE Plasma Version: 6.4.3
KDE Frameworks Version: 6.16.0
Qt Version: 6.10 (838d543cd2adddce6419faa91647192653d71088)
ADDITIONAL INFORMATION
Wayland behaviour not tested at all.
